My car just won't idle! It back fired big time under load two weeks ago then ran like a bag of spanners, this turned out to be a split & perished induction pipe onto the turbo and a knackered MAF sensor, both of which have been replaced, as well as the radiator which was cracked and spraying a fine mist onto the induction kit. Also the spark plugs, injectors. HT leads, fuel pressure and boost controller were checked and working fine. I got the car back end of last week and it ran & idled fine but since the weekend it just won't idle so i checked the diagnostics and it showed MAF & idle control valve problems. Today i replaced the idle control valve and reset the ECU and it shows no problems on the diagnostics but it still won't idle it just keeps stalling!
Could the idle be set to low? Anyone got any ideas?

2 big causes of maf failure. There has also been a spate of '99 mafs not lasting long recently. I would think that is almost certainly your problem.
If you have the std airbox put it back on. Or if you want an induction kit the foam ones seem to be prefered, GGR and the like though I never tried one myself.

Can't refit the OE air box the FMIC pipework is in the way. I thought the K&N filters were supposed to be "MAF sensor friendly"?. I seems to idle better when the air con is on that's why i thought it might be a low idle problem?
I'm in a similar situation with my '99 typeR .I have just fitted a fmic & apexi induction kit and found that if the filter gets damp or the under bonnet temps.are high that i get poor tickover/running probs. i think the maf is running things lean and plan to construct an airbox and also switch to a map based ecu, possibly a gems or the new hydra , as the maf seems to be something of a weak link when trying to modify.
